Solution for -3(1+5x)=3(-4x-2) equation:


Simplifying
-3(1 + 5x) = 3(-4x + -2)
(1 * -3 + 5x * -3) = 3(-4x + -2)
(-3 + -15x) = 3(-4x + -2)

Reorder the terms:
-3 + -15x = 3(-2 + -4x)
-3 + -15x = (-2 * 3 + -4x * 3)
-3 + -15x = (-6 + -12x)

Solving
-3 + -15x = -6 + -12x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'12x' to each side of the equation.
-3 + -15x + 12x = -6 + -12x + 12x

Combine like terms: -15x + 12x = -3x
-3 + -3x = -6 + -12x + 12x

Combine like terms: -12x + 12x = 0
-3 + -3x = -6 + 0
-3 + -3x = -6

Add '3' to each side of the equation.
-3 + 3 + -3x = -6 + 3

Combine like terms: -3 + 3 = 0
0 + -3x = -6 + 3
-3x = -6 + 3

Combine like terms: -6 + 3 = -3
-3x = -3

Divide each side by '-3'.
x = 1

Simplifying
x = 1
